Why do I pay for phone service each month?

Telephone service is not centrally funded by the university. Telecommunications is a service center that’s funded by a self supporting budget. Each project, program, department, or school is charged for the services received.

Am I required to use a university phone number?

It’s a good idea to use university equipment, phone numbers, and systems for university business. Personal phones used for work or university business may contain records that become discoverable under the Freedom of Information Act. An employee may work in a school or department that requires the use of a university phone. Speak to your supervisor for more information.

How do I get my voicemail from off-campus?
  1. Dial 702-774-4900.
  2. Press the * key to access the login prompt.
  3. Enter the five digit directory number followed by #.
  4. Enter the mailbox pin followed by #.
  5. The automated attendant will guide the caller to listen to messages or change settings.
How do I navigate through voice mail?

Use the following keys to manage your messages and to control playback.

While Listening to a Message

  • 1 = Restart Message
  • 2 = Save
  • 3 = Delete
  • 4 = Slow Down
  • 5 = Change Volume
  • 6 = Speed up
  • 7 = Rewind, Small
  • 8 = Pause or Resume
  • 9 = Fast-forward to end

After Listening to a Message

  • 1 = Replay Message
  • 2 = Save
  • 3 = Delete
  • 4 = Reply
  • 5 = Forward Message
  • 6 = Save as Unheard
  • 7 = Rewind, Small
  • 9 = Play Message Summary

How do I make calls?

The university does not use a dialing prefix. Dial the number you want to reach.

  • Internal: Five-digit directory number
  • Local: Ten-digit phone number
  • Domestic: 1+Area Code+Number
  • International: 011+Country Code+City Code+Number
  • Directory Assistance*: 702+555+1212

*If you dial a “1” before the area code, you will be charged for a long distance call.

How do I transfer a call?
  1. While on active call, press the Transfer key.
  2. Dial the number to which you are transferring the call.
  3. When you hear ringing, press Transfer again, or when the party answers, announce the call and press Transfer.
  4. Hang up to end your participation in the call.
How do I transfer a caller directly to voicemail?
  1. Press the Transfer soft key.
  2. Press * key on the dial pad.
  3. Enter the five digit directory number followed by the # key.
  4. Press the Transfer soft key immediately to complete the transfer.

How do I use the UNLV address book?
  1. Press the Directories button.
  2. Use the Scroll key to select UNLV Employee Directory.
  3. Use the Scroll key to select the search option: Last Name, First Name, Extension.
  4. Use the numbers corresponding to the letters on the dial pad to enter a name or number to find it in the directory.
  5. Press the Search soft key to search for the listing.
  6. Press the Dial soft key to speed dial a number from the UNLV Address Book.
